Implementing Highly Precise search engine optimization advertising Campaigns
Step 1: Conduct Deep Search Intent Mapping
Identify core pain points and decision triggers among target client segments. Use tools like Google Search Console combined with intent surveys to classify queries into informational, navigational, and transactional buckets. This groundwork ensures ad messaging aligns tightly with user expectations, fostering higher engagement rates.
Such mapping isn’t static. Refresh it monthly based on performance data and evolving industry keywords. Firms like EY have pioneered dynamic intent models, continuously adjusting bid strategies and content themes to reflect current user needs, which notably reduces bounce rates by nearly 30% in competitive verticals.
Step 2: Develop Hyper-Relevant Creative and Landing Pages
Matching ad content to intent signals dramatically improves conversion. For example, replacing generic “consult with an expert” CTAs with specific, value-driven offers like “Schedule your free 15-minute initial tax consultation” results in 2.7x higher lead engagement. Landing pages must mirror the language and informational depth of the ads, ensuring a seamless user experience that addresses explicit queries and implicit needs.
Optimization involves rigorous multivariate testing—testing headlines, form fields, and trust signals—guided by analytics from platforms like Unbounce and Hotjar. This iterative process ensures content relevance at each funnel stage, a tactic proven effective by firms like KPMG in accelerating qualified lead capture.
Step 3: Integrate Technical and On-Page SEO with Paid Campaigns
Technical health—including site speed, structured data, and mobile responsiveness—can boost ad quality scores and organic rankings simultaneously. A financial advisory firm, for instance, saw a 42% improvement in ad impact after optimizing page load times from 4.3 to 1.8 seconds.
On-page SEO must be tightly woven into paid efforts, with a focus on semantic relevance and NLP-driven keyword clusters. Using tools like SEMrush or Ahrefs, firms can identify keyword gaps while aligning paid ad themes, ensuring both channels reinforce each other and captivate search engines’ evolving algorithms.
Maximizing ROI Through Technical search engine optimization advertising Strategies
Technical excellence underpins impactful search engine optimization advertising. Speed, crawlability, and structured data serve as bedrock for search visibility—yet many overlook their encoded influence on paid ad relevance. Fast-loading, technically sound pages are rewarded with higher quality scores, leading to lower CPCs and higher ad placements.
For instance, a wealth management firm that restructured its website’s schema markup and reduced load times increased its ad impression share by 22%, simultaneously dropping CPCs by 14%. Integrating technical audit tools like Screaming Frog and Google Lighthouse into campaign workflows ensures continuous optimization. This technical foundation payoff translates into a 17% lift in qualified leads and an overall 25% reduction in cost-per-acquisition, outperforming industry averages.
